Checking your Toyota Land Cruiser’s brake fluid takes only a few minutes, but the result can reveal worn brake pads, a hydraulic leak, contamination, or overdue service. Because reservoir locations and approved fluid grades vary by model year and market, use the steps below together with the owner’s manual for your exact Land Cruiser.
Quick Answer
Park on level ground, switch the vehicle off, and find the translucent reservoir attached to the brake master cylinder. The level should be between MIN and MAX. Use only the DOT grade listed in your model-year manual. If the level is below MIN, the warning light is on, or the pedal feels soft, arrange brake service before driving.
Key Takeaways
- Check the level through the translucent reservoir before removing its cap.
- The fluid should remain between the molded MIN and MAX marks.
- A slight decline can occur as brake pads wear, but sudden or repeated loss may indicate a leak.
- Use only the fluid standard approved for your exact model year. Do not assume every Land Cruiser accepts the same grade.
- Do not drive with a red brake warning, a soft or sinking pedal, a visible leak, or unexplained fluid below MIN.

Warning: Do not keep driving if the red brake-system warning stays on, the pedal feels soft or sinks toward the floor, braking power has changed, fluid is visibly leaking, or the reservoir is below MIN for an unknown reason. Park safely and have the Land Cruiser inspected or towed.
Locate the Brake Fluid Reservoir

On many left-hand-drive Toyota Land Cruisers, the brake fluid reservoir is near the rear of the engine compartment on the driver’s side. It is a translucent plastic tank attached to, or positioned above, the brake master cylinder near the firewall.
The exact location can change with the generation, engine, hybrid system, and driving-side configuration. A right-hand-drive model may place the components on the opposite side. Confirm the location with the engine-compartment diagram in your model-year Toyota Land Cruiser owner’s manual.
Look for these identifying features:
- A small translucent or lightly colored reservoir.
- Molded MIN and MAX level marks.
- A cap labeled for brake fluid or displaying the approved fluid standard.
- A position close to the brake master cylinder rather than the radiator or windshield-washer tank.
Pro Tip: Use a flashlight to read the fluid line through the side of the reservoir. A normal visual inspection does not require you to remove the cap, which helps keep moisture and dirt out.
Quick Visual Check: Level and Fluid Condition
Park the Land Cruiser on firm, level ground. Apply the parking brake, shift into Park, switch the engine or hybrid system off, and keep the key away from the vehicle while you work. Let hot engine-compartment parts cool before reaching near the reservoir.
- Clean the outside: Wipe dust and loose debris from the reservoir and cap without opening it.
- Read the level: View the fluid through the translucent wall. Toyota’s general owner guidance says the level should be between the MIN and MAX marks.
- Check for a sudden drop: Compare the current level with earlier checks if you have a maintenance record.
- Inspect for leaks: Look for wetness around the master cylinder, brake hoses, hard lines, calipers, fittings, and the ground under the vehicle.
- Check the appearance: Note unusual cloudiness, visible particles, separation, or a very dark color.
- Check the pedal and warning lights: A soft pedal, sinking pedal, reduced braking, or red brake warning requires immediate professional attention.
A small, gradual reduction can occur as brake-pad material wears and the caliper pistons move farther outward. However, fluid that falls below MIN, drops quickly, or needs repeated topping up may indicate a leak or another brake-system problem.
New DOT 3 and DOT 4 brake fluid is generally colorless to amber under Federal Motor Vehicle Safety Standard No. 116. Fluid can become darker during service, but color alone does not accurately measure moisture content, boiling point, or remaining service life.
Note: Dark fluid is a reason to review the service history and request a condition check. Cloudiness, sediment, water separation, petroleum contamination, or an unknown fluid type requires more urgent service.
Add the Right Brake Fluid: Types and Compatibility
Use only the brake fluid listed on the reservoir cap, in the owner’s manual, or in the maintenance-data section for your exact Land Cruiser. Specifications can change between model years and countries.
For example, the 2026 U.S. and Canada Land Cruiser Owner’s Manual lists either:
- SAE J1703 or FMVSS No. 116 DOT 3 brake fluid; or
- SAE J1704 or FMVSS No. 116 DOT 4 brake fluid.
This current specification does not prove that every older Land Cruiser accepts both grades. Some previous models may specify one particular standard. Always let the model-year manual control your choice.
| Fluid | Use in a Land Cruiser |
|---|---|
| DOT 3 | Use only when the manual or reservoir cap permits DOT 3 or SAE J1703. |
| DOT 4 | Use only when the manual or reservoir cap permits DOT 4 or SAE J1704. |
| DOT 5 silicone | Do not add it unless Toyota expressly specifies it. It is not listed for the cited 2026 Land Cruiser. |
| DOT 5.1 | Do not substitute it merely because its name sounds newer. Use it only if the model-year manual expressly approves it. |

How to Top Up the Reservoir Safely
Do not automatically add fluid whenever the level is slightly below MAX. If pad wear caused the decline, filling the reservoir to the top can make it overflow when new pads are installed and the caliper pistons are pushed back.
If the manual permits owner top-up, the level is genuinely low, and no active leak or brake symptom is present:
- Confirm the exact approved DOT or SAE specification.
- Use a newly opened, sealed container from a reliable supplier.
- Clean the reservoir cap and surrounding area before opening it.
- Wear gloves and safety glasses, and protect nearby paint with clean rags.
- Use a clean funnel reserved only for brake fluid.
- Add a small amount at a time while watching the level.
- Stop when the level is safely between MIN and MAX. Do not overfill.
- Install the cap securely to limit dirt and moisture contamination.
- Wipe up any spill immediately and rinse an affected painted surface with plenty of water.
The reservoir cap helps keep the fluid clean and dry. It does not create the hydraulic pressure used to apply the brakes.
Troubleshooting Low, High, or Dark Brake Fluid

The fluid level and appearance can provide useful clues, but they should be considered together with pedal feel, warning lights, brake-pad condition, leak evidence, and service history.
| Finding | Possible Meaning | Recommended Action |
|---|---|---|
| Slightly lower but above MIN | Normal brake-pad wear may be increasing the fluid volume held in the calipers. | Inspect pad wear and monitor the level. Do not automatically fill to MAX. |
| Below MIN or dropping quickly | Possible leak, severe pad wear, master-cylinder issue, or another hydraulic fault. | Do not drive until the cause is found and repaired. |
| Above MAX | Previous overfilling, recent brake work, or an incorrect reading procedure. | Do not remove fluid with a dirty tool. Have the level corrected using the model-specific procedure. |
| Dark but clear | Age, heat exposure, or normal discoloration may be present. | Review service history and have the condition tested if replacement timing is uncertain. |
| Cloudy, separated, or gritty | Possible water, dirt, petroleum, or incompatible-fluid contamination. | Stop adding fluid and arrange professional inspection and service. |

Low Fluid Causes
Low fluid can result from normal pad wear, but a sudden drop or frequent need for fluid is not normal. Check for wetness at the following areas without crawling beneath an unsupported vehicle:
- The brake master cylinder and reservoir.
- Hard brake lines and flexible hoses.
- Calipers, bleeder screws, and hose connections.
- The inside of each wheel and the ground where the vehicle was parked.
- Any component recently opened during brake service.
Do not treat a top-up as a repair. Adding fluid may temporarily raise the reservoir level while leaving a leak, worn pads, or a faulty component unresolved.
High Reservoir Risks
A reservoir above MAX is often the result of unnecessary topping up or brake work that pushed fluid back toward the reservoir. It may overflow when worn pads are replaced and the caliper pistons are retracted.
Brake fluid can damage painted surfaces. Do not use a household baster, syringe, funnel, or other contaminated tool to remove excess fluid. A technician should correct the level with clean equipment and check why it became overfilled.
On Land Cruisers with electronically controlled brakes, the specified fluid-checking state may depend on the brake actuator or accumulator. Follow the exact owner or repair manual rather than repeatedly switching the vehicle on and off in an attempt to change the reading.
Dark Fluid Actions
Darkening can occur as brake fluid ages, but it does not prove by itself that the fluid has reached an unsafe moisture level. Use these checks together:
- Appearance: Look for cloudiness, sediment, separation, or an unusual color.
- Service history: Find out when the fluid was last replaced and whether the hydraulic system was opened.
- Brake feel: Treat a soft, sinking, or inconsistent pedal as an urgent problem.
- Condition test: Ask a qualified shop to evaluate the fluid when its history or condition is uncertain.
- Correct service: Use the Toyota bleeding procedure for the exact model, especially when an electronically controlled actuator is involved.
When to Flush or Replace Brake Fluid
There is no single replacement interval that can safely be applied to every Land Cruiser generation and market. Follow the warranty and maintenance guide supplied with your exact vehicle.
For example, the U.S. 2025 Toyota Land Cruiser Warranty and Maintenance Guide calls for inspection of brake-fluid level and condition during scheduled maintenance. It does not establish a universal rule that every Land Cruiser must receive a fluid flush exactly every two years.
Brake-fluid replacement or professional evaluation is appropriate when:
- Your model-year maintenance guide specifies replacement.
- The fluid is contaminated, cloudy, separated, or contains particles.
- A moisture or boiling-point condition test indicates that service is needed.
- The fluid type is unknown or an incorrect fluid may have been added.
- A brake hose, caliper, master cylinder, actuator, or hydraulic line has been opened or replaced.
- The brake pedal is soft after hydraulic work.
- The service history is unknown and a technician recommends replacement after inspection.
Warning: Bleeding a modern Land Cruiser is not always a conventional two-person pedal-pumping job. Electronically controlled brake systems may require a scan tool, a specific ignition state, and a Toyota repair-manual sequence. An incorrect procedure can leave air trapped in the actuator and reduce braking performance.
Brake-fluid color is a useful warning clue, but the correct service decision also depends on the model-year schedule, fluid history, contamination, warning lights, pedal feel, and hydraulic-system condition.

Maintenance and Safety Tips
Brake fluid absorbs moisture and can damage paint. Treat the reservoir, cap, funnel, and fluid container as clean components throughout the job.
Prevent Paint Damage
- Wear chemical-resistant gloves and safety glasses.
- Place clean rags around the reservoir before opening it.
- Use a small, clean funnel reserved only for brake fluid.
- Pour slowly and stop below MAX.
- Wipe minor drips immediately.
- Rinse affected paint with plenty of clean water rather than rubbing the fluid across the surface.
- Do not leave fluid-soaked rags in the engine compartment.
If brake fluid contacts your skin or eyes, rinse the affected area with clean water. Seek medical care if irritation continues.
Avoid Moisture Absorption
Federal brake-fluid labeling rules direct users to keep the fluid clean and dry, store it in its original container, and keep the container tightly closed. Toyota’s owner guidance also advises using newly opened fluid.
- Clean the reservoir before opening it.
- Keep the cap off only as long as necessary.
- Never pour unused fluid back into its original container.
- Do not use fluid from an open bottle with an unknown storage history.
- Do not transfer brake fluid into an unmarked container.
- Keep petroleum products, water, dirt, and cleaning solvents away from the reservoir.
- Dispose of unwanted or used fluid according to local hazardous-waste rules.
Frequently Asked Questions
Can you drive with a low brake-fluid level?
Do not continue driving when the fluid is below MIN for an unknown reason, the red brake warning stays on, a leak is visible, or the pedal feels soft or sinks. These signs can indicate reduced braking ability or a hydraulic fault. Park safely and arrange an inspection or tow.
Should I fill the reservoir to MAX whenever the level drops?
No. A slight decline can occur as brake pads wear. Filling the reservoir to MAX without checking the pads can cause an overfill when new pads are installed and the pistons are pushed back. The level should remain within the approved range, and any unexplained loss should be diagnosed.
What brake fluid does a Toyota Land Cruiser use?
The required fluid depends on the model year and market. The 2026 U.S. and Canada Land Cruiser manual lists SAE J1703 or FMVSS DOT 3 and SAE J1704 or FMVSS DOT 4. Older or non-U.S. models may differ, so confirm the specification on the reservoir cap and in the exact owner’s manual.
Can I use DOT 5 or DOT 5.1 because the number is higher?
No. A higher number does not automatically make a fluid suitable for your vehicle. DOT 5 is silicone based, and the cited 2026 Land Cruiser specification does not list DOT 5 or DOT 5.1. Use only the standard Toyota approves for your exact model.
Does dark brake fluid always need an immediate flush?
Not based on color alone. Darkening is a reason to check the service history and fluid condition, but it does not directly measure moisture content or boiling point. Cloudy fluid, particles, separation, an unknown fluid type, or brake symptoms require faster professional attention.
How often should Land Cruiser brake fluid be replaced?
Follow the maintenance guide for the exact model year and country. Toyota’s U.S. Land Cruiser guidance may call for regular fluid-level and condition inspections rather than one universal replacement interval. Replace the fluid when the schedule, condition test, contamination, or hydraulic repair requires it.
Can I flush the Land Cruiser brake system at home?
A visual check and careful top-up may be suitable for an owner who follows the manual. A complete flush can require model-specific steps, especially on electronically controlled brake systems. Use the Toyota repair procedure and proper scan equipment, or have a qualified technician perform the work.
